    Jon Olsson Making His RS6 The Most Outrageous In The World

    We know Jon Olsson for having the most epic creations and we know he has the beastly camo Audi RS6 but now he has decided to take this car to a whole new level. The car has been sent in for major modifications and this project is being called the Audi RS6 DTM and as you can see from the build photo’s, it is going to look mental.



    This is what he had to say on his blog;


    “So here you go, some picks of the RS6, I kind of hate showing pics during the build process as you really have to have good imagination to see what the finished product will look like. There are basically two ways to rebuild a car like this, you can scan it and build the parts in 3D or you can do it the old fashion way if you are a super surgeon with shaping tools (like Leif is) I like the old fashion way as you can really see what the car is going to look like when you have it infront of you, and I love trying out shapes with cardboard and tape! This way you shape the parts on the car and then build a mould and create the parts from there. As you can see this is going to be kind of nuts, even for me! haha Great to play around with tape and find the last design details though, I know is not for everyone, but I always wanted to do a DTM inspired car, what do you guys think, wild enough?”
